PALESTRONI v. JACOBS


10 N.J. Super. 266 (1950)

77 A.2d 183

ALFIERO PALESTRONI, PLAINTIFF-RESPONDENT, v. HARRIET KALISHER JACOBS, DEFENDANT-APPELLANT.

Superior Court of New Jersey, Appellate Division.

Decided November 27, 1950.


Attorney(s) appearing for the Case

Mr. Louis J. Greenberg argued the cause for appellant.

Mr. Eugene T. Sharkey argued the cause for respondent (Mr. John J. Wygant, attorney).

Before Judges McGEEHAN, JAYNE and WM. J. BRENNAN, JR.


The opinion of the court was delivered by WILLIAM J. BRENNAN, JR., J.A.D.

Defendant appeals from a judgment entered in the Bergen County Court upon a jury verdict in plaintiff's favor for a balance due and extras under a building contract. Defendant sought and was denied a new trial for alleged error of the trial judge who, without prior notice to defendant or her counsel, supplied the jurors with a dictionary at their request while they were deliberating.
